PRIMARY DUTIES

Maintains and builds customer relationships by ensuring customer requests are met in a timely fashion.Designs layouts for service additions and changes to the Company electric system using Company approved standards and policies. Performs technical calculations and prepares work orders as assigned.Communicates internally and externally the Company requirements for electric service installation.Designs, negotiates, and coordinates the installation of residential, commercial, and industrial services including the preparation of cost estimates, work orders, and written service agreements as assignee works with others (e.g. Supervisors, Sr. Consultants, Engineers) to prepare work orders for larger commercial and industrial service installations.Prepares easement documents and private property permits as required for services and extensions on private property.Designs, negotiates and coordinates the relocation of overhead and underground facilities, including the preparation of work orders and cost estimates as assigned.Recommends designs and coordinates installation of residential streetlights. Prepares work orders for the installation of security lighting and unmetered services for customers. Prepares residential or commercial contracts as assigned.Performs analysis/assistance in emergency restoration in the facilitation of restoration efforts. Expected to work beyond regular business hours as required.

E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ES

An Associate’s degree in Engineering or Engineering Technology or related field or a High School diploma or the equivalent and one year of formal technical training is required.

Four to Six (4-6) years of related electrical distribution experience is required.

Refer to Time Merit Progression (TMP) for experience required for each step.

Technical Skills: Sound knowledge of electrical distribution systems and construction standards and techniques.Internal Contacts: Various departments, Customer Service, Transportation, Stores, IT, Telecommunications personnel/departments, Real Estate, Analysts, Planners, Managers and Supervisors, Engineers, Circuit Owners, Zone Managers and Clerical / Secretarial support.External Contacts: Customers, contractors, municipal and state contact persons, business and utility representatives.Challenges: Meet internal and external customer expectations and improve overall customer satisfaction.
